Transaction 36348598cfcb9102b78ed91a97ca31b519d6284c3e897601e7e5df826833d837

1 Input
2 Outputs
  • 36348598cfcb9102b78ed91a97ca31b519d6284c3e897601e7e5df826833d837:0
  • value  301790
    address  3FH28f4N7YUCtN9XBhFFudKhoHQ2Hh4YgB
  • 36348598cfcb9102b78ed91a97ca31b519d6284c3e897601e7e5df826833d837:1
  • value  70268946
    address  3DSdfxP2YZRtSE9XwrmVjBPwyNR1kfR8on